About Dua

I am a medical doctor with a strong interest in teaching and knowledge sharing. My teaching style is structured, clinically oriented, and focused on building true understanding rather than rote memorization. I emphasize linking basic sciences to real clinical practice, helping learners develop clear clinical reasoning and decision-making skills.

I adapt my lessons to each learner’s level and goals, whether they are medical students, interns, or graduates preparing for licensing or equivalency exams. My sessions are interactive, case-based, and aligned with evidence-based guidelines and exam-oriented high-yield concepts.

I value clarity, organization, and a supportive learning environment where students feel comfortable asking questions and developing confidence in their medical knowledge. My goal is to help learners not only succeed academically, but also think like safe and competent clinicians.

1. Teaching Method and Techniques

My teaching approach as a doctor is evidence-based, clinically oriented, and learner-centered, with a strong focus on understanding rather than memorization.

I teach by linking basic sciences to clinical practice, helping learners understand not only what to know, but why it matters in real patient care. Medical concepts are introduced in a structured, logical sequence, progressing from foundational principles to applied clinical reasoning.

Key teaching techniques include:

Concept-based teaching rather than rote learning

Use of clinical scenarios and case discussions

Step-by-step explanation of mechanisms and reasoning

Integration of guidelines and evidence-based medicine

Active questioning to assess understanding

Regular reinforcement through summaries and revision

The teaching style is adaptive and tailored to the learner’s level, goals, and examination requirements.

2. Typical Lesson Plan

Each lesson follows a structured and goal-oriented format:

Learning Objectives

Clear definition of what the student should understand or be able to do by the end of the session

Conceptual Foundation

Brief review of essential background knowledge

Explanation of core concepts using simplified, logical steps

Clinical Application

Discussion of real or simulated patient cases

Correlation between symptoms, investigations, diagnosis, and management

Exam and Guideline Focus

Highlighting high-yield points

Emphasis on common exam pitfalls and frequently tested concepts

Alignment with current clinical guidelines where appropriate

Assessment and Feedback

Short questions, clinical vignettes, or problem-solving tasks

Immediate clarification of errors and misconceptions

Consolidation

Summary of key take-home messages

Targeted assignments or revision tasks

Lessons are interactive and encourage clinical reasoning rather than passive listening.
